126 interior door removal
i have a 300sdl and want to work on the door lock, i have been told you have to know the sequence of how to remove the interior of door
i would appreciate any knowledge of this. thankyou all ahead of time mike |

Unscrew the arm rest. Remove the plastic guard from behind the door handle. Remove the decorative trim over the cone lock. Take out the window switch and the seat controls. Pop off the door panel and remove any attached wires.

Pull the door handle and pry the plastic out with a screwdriver. The screw is behind it.
There is always a possibility that the plastic clips will break. It's an old car. Get some at the dealer.

The door panel has clips at the top that will break on the 126, unless you LIFT the panel up. Check the search for an in depth discussion.
